首页--工业技术论文--自动化技术、计算机技术论文--计算技术、计算机技术论文--计算机的应用论文--计算机网络论文--一般性问题论文

基于NetMagic平台的Open vSwitch交换机的设计与实现

摘要第4-5页
ABSTRACT第5页
第一章 绪论第8-12页
    1.1 课题研究背景第8-10页
    1.2 论文主要工作第10-11页
    1.3 论文结构第11-12页
第二章 相关技术介绍与概述第12-22页
    2.1 SDN架构第12-16页
        2.1.1 SDN的起源第12页
        2.1.2 SDN架构第12-16页
    2.2 开源SDN软件交换机第16-17页
        2.2.1 ofsoftswitch13第16-17页
        2.2.2 Open vSwitch第17页
        2.2.3 Linc第17页
    2.3 商用硬件SDN交换机第17-18页
        2.3.1 盛科商用交换机第18页
        2.3.2 Pica8商用交换机第18页
    2.4 NETMAGIC平台第18-19页
    2.5 本章小结第19-22页
第三章 基于NETMAGIC平台OPEN VSWITCH交换机需求分析第22-40页
    3.1 功能性需求分析第22-37页
        3.1.1 Open vSwitch软件功能分析第22-31页
        3.1.2 NetMagic平台硬件功能分析第31-33页
        3.1.3 Open vSwitch软件功能卸载需求分析第33-37页
    3.2 非功能性需求分析第37-38页
    3.3 本章小结第38-40页
第四章 基于NETMAGIC的OPEN VSWITCH交换机总体设计第40-56页
    4.1 交换机总体架构设计第40-41页
    4.2 数据包IO需求相关模块总体设计第41-47页
        4.2.1 PCIe驱动模块设计第42页
        4.2.2 SDB数据包与SKB数据包之间的转换设计第42-45页
        4.2.3 控制类SKB数据包对硬件管理缓冲区的适配设计第45-47页
        4.2.4 虚拟以太网驱动模块设计第47页
    4.3 OPEN VSWITCH的内核流表卸载相关模块总体设计第47-55页
        4.3.1 TCAM表项管理模块设计第48-50页
        4.3.2 硬件流表项提取模块设计第50-51页
        4.3.3 硬件数据包查找转发模块设计第51-52页
        4.3.4 NetMagic平台对硬件流表项解析存储模块设计第52页
        4.3.5 TCAM的API模块设计第52-55页
    4.4 本章小结第55-56页
第五章 基于NETMAGIC的硬件交换机的详细设计第56-68页
    5.1 数据包IO需求相关详细设计第56-60页
        5.1.1 PCle驱动模块详细设计第56-57页
        5.1.2 SDB数据包与SKB数据包之间转换详细设计第57页
        5.1.3 控制类SKB数据包适配硬件管理缓冲区的详细设计第57-59页
        5.1.4 虚拟以太网驱动模块详细设计第59-60页
    5.2 OPEN VSWITCH内核流表项卸载的详细设计第60-66页
        5.2.1 TCAM表项管理模块详细设计第60-63页
        5.2.2 硬件流表项提取模块详细设计第63-64页
        5.2.3 TCAM的API模块详细设计第64-66页
    5.3 本章小结第66-68页
第六章 基于NETMAGIC平台的OPEN VSWITCH交换机测试方案第68-72页
    6.1 实验设备配置信息第68-69页
    6.2 实验拓扑第69页
    6.3 实验方案第69-71页
        6.3.1 平均TCP/UDP吞吐率测试方案第69-70页
        6.3.2 平均TCP/UDP丢包率测试方案第70页
        6.3.3 多流表下吞吐率对比测试方案第70-71页
    6.4 本章小结第71-72页
第七章 展望与总结第72-74页
参考文献第74-76页
致谢第76-78页
作者攻读学位期间发表的学术论文目录第78页

论文共78页,点击 下载论文
上一篇:IP网络流量分析系统的设计与实现
下一篇:微博话题的传播特性分析与建模